Best Window supplier in Stockport, united kingdom

Uksashwindows Ltd

43 Dialstone Ln Stockport SK2 6AA United Kingdom

The Cheshire Window Outlet Ltd

37 Hall Moss Ln Bramhall Stockport SK7 1RB United Kingdom